WebApr 27, 2024 · A recount is a real event that happened to you, it is a personal and real experiance. It cannot fictional or made up. The recount should be of a meaningful event, nothing too basic or simplistic. WebBringing recount and critically reflective writing together Both recount and critical reflection writing are part of your reflecting on practice. Tell the story and then explore the impacts past, current and future on your work.
